Corsair Vengeance DDR5-6000 2x48GB CL36 vs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6800 2x48GB in detail
True latency
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6800 2x48GB is the lower-latency kit at 11.77 ns, against 12.00 ns for Corsair Vengeance DDR5-6000 2x48GB CL36 — a difference of 0.23 ns. That figure is what reconciles the two spec sheets: CAS latency counts clock cycles, so it only means something next to the clock it counts. Corsair Vengeance DDR5-6000 2x48GB CL36 runs 6000 MT/s at CL36;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6800 2x48GB runs 6800 MT/s at CL40.
Transfer rate
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6800 2x48GB is rated 6800 MT/s against 6000 MT/s for Corsair Vengeance DDR5-6000 2x48GB CL36 — 54400 MB/s per module, against 48000 MB/s. That is peak transfer rate, not access time: reaching a higher clock costs more cycles on each access, which is why the CAS numbers differ too, and why the true latency above is the figure that compares directly.
